Description

Wood apple, is a distinct-looking fruit with a rough and hard greenish-brown or grayish-brown color. They are typically round to oval in shape and pack edible pulp inside the hard shell that you can eat once you break the shell or crack it open. The flesh inside can be ivory to yellow in color when young and as it ages, it may turn orange-brown to dark brown in color. Wood apples are generally unique in taste, they are a mix of sweet & tangy flavors alongside grainy, sticky, and moist in consistency.

Shelf Life and Storage

Wood apples have a shelf life of 3 to 5 days. We recommend consuming the fruit as it arrives. You can keep the wood apples at room temperature until they are ripe. Knock on the outer shell and if it cracks or becomes brittle, that's your cue that the fruit is ripe. Keep the ripe wood apple in the refrigerator to extend its shelf life if not consumed right away.


Nutritional Value (Per 100 gms)

- Calories: 141 kcal
- Carbohydrates: 34.7 grams
- Sugars: 23.8 grams
- Dietary Fiber: 14.4 grams
- Fat: 0.5 grams
- Potassium: 261mg


Health Benefits

Better Digestive Health:

The pulp of wood apples is high in fiber content that helps prevent common digestive issues such as constipation. The fiber acts as a probiotic which is beneficial for gut bacteria and helps improve bowel movements.

 

Good for the Heart:

Wood apples are good for the heart as well. They are rich in dietary fiber that may help lower levels of LDL or bad cholesterol. It is rich in potassium which is a mineral that removes excessive sodium out of the blood that otherwise triggers high blood pressure. They are low in glycemic index and won't adversely spike blood sugar levels helping those with diabetes or those at risk 

Strengthens Urinary Health:

Wood apples have diuretic properties that promote increased urine production. The benefits include flushing of toxins and bacteria out of the urinary tract, and lower fluid retention that could otherwise cause bloating and swelling. It is also good for kidneys as its diuretic properties help remove waste and excess salt keeping the kidney health in check.
